Martin,

Excellent analysis and summary on the media info examples. It's good
to see this making progress.

The only suggested feedback/improvement I have at this time is to
consider the principle of modularity:

http://microformats.org/wiki/principles

and perhaps separate out a few bits, thus simplifying a potential
media info microformat.

That is, see how much of a media info posting can be marked up as an
hAtom entry, and then produce a media info schema based on what
remains, rather than what hAtom has already marked up, e.g.
* published
* comment - should probably go into an iteration of hAtom or a
separate microformat instead, see existing work:
http://microformats.org/wiki/comment (links to a lot of pre-existing work)

Also, for "alternate", see http://microformats.org/wiki/alternates (ditto).
